Glimpsetv: A Nigerian female soldier has called out a civilian prankster and content creator who poured water on her while she was in uniform, all in the name of a prank. According to the soldier, she seized the prankster’s phone at the scene, but the female content creator still went ahead and posted the video online.
She revealed that it was her colleagues who woke her up with calls in the morning, sending her the now-viral video. That was when she realized the prankster must have used a second phone to film the incident and uploaded it despite her phone being seized.
Reacting to the situation and showing the part of the video where the prankster poured water on her, the soldier said, “I’m waiting for her to come and collect this phone. I’ll teach her how to prank. These Nigerian pranksters need to learn a lot. Since they don’t know how to respect people, they will learn...”
The video has sparked mixed reactions online. While many condemned the prankster’s actions, others are eagerly watching to see if she will dare to retrieve the phone from the soldier.

LAMATA Goes Wood: Innovative Solution to Drain Manhole Cover Theft
The Lagos Metropolitan Area Transport Authority (LAMATA) is implementing a clever and cost-effective solution to the persistent problem of metal manhole cover theft at BRT laybys across the state.
